Venue / Location

  • City and Country: Florence, Italy
  • Venue Name: Fortezza da Basso
  • Google Maps Address: V.le Filippo Strozzi, 1, 50129 Firenze FI, Italy

Getting There

  • Nearest Airport: Florence Peretola Airport, situated approximately six kilometers from the venue with direct tramway and taxi connections.
  • Nearest Train/Metro Station: Firenze Santa Maria Novella Railway Station, located within walking distance of the exhibition entrance.
  • Bus Routes or Public Transport Options: Extensive urban ATAF bus lines and the modern T1 tramway network link all parts of Florence directly to the fortress gates.
  • Parking Availability: Limited surrounding municipal parking options exist, with dedicated multi-level facilities located near the station and major transit arteries.
  • Directions by Car: Accessible via the A1 Autostrada del Sole by following signs toward the Florence central exits and navigating toward viale Filippo Strozzi.

Is the event open to the general public?

Admission is strictly restricted to verified business professionals, retail buyers, store owners, fashion agents, and accredited media personnel actively working within the industry. General consumers lacking professional trade credentials are not permitted to register or enter the exhibition pavilions.
